Description and operation

DescriptionIgnition timing is controlled by the electronic control ignition timing system. The standard reference ignition timing data for the engine operating conditions are preprogrammed in the memory of the ECM (Engine Control Module)...

Hyundai Ioniq (AE) 2017-2024 Service Manual: Muffler. Repair procedures


Removal and InstallationFront Muffler1.Disconnect the battery negative terminal.2.Disconnect the oxygen sensor connector (A).3.Remove the heat protector (A). Tightening torque : 9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b-ft)4.Remove the front muffler (A)...

Air Bag Warning Labels

Hyundai Ioniq. Air Bag Warning Labels

Air bag warning labels, required by the U.S. National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), are attached to alert the driver and passengers of potential risks of the air bag system. Be sure to read all of the information about the air bags that are installed on your vehicle in this Owners Manual.
